1. Determining the Stepper Motor Driver Voltage

Hybrid stepper motor drivers typically operate within a wide voltage range, such as 12–48VDC for the IM483 model. The selected power supply voltage should be based on the motor’s operating speed and response requirements. If the motor needs to run at a higher speed or requires faster response times, a higher voltage is generally recommended. However, it's important to ensure that the voltage ripple does not exceed the driver’s maximum input voltage rating. Exceeding this limit could potentially damage the driver.

2. Determining the Stepper Motor Driver Current

The power supply current is usually determined by the driver’s output phase current (I). For linear power supplies, the supply current should typically be between 1.1 to 1.3 times the rated phase current. In contrast, for switching power supplies, the supply current should be around 1.5 to 2.0 times the phase current. This ensures stable operation and prevents overheating or performance issues under load.

3. Additional Considerations

In addition to voltage and current, it's also important to consider the type of driver being used—whether it's a unipolar or bipolar driver—as this can affect how the motor behaves. Proper cooling and heat dissipation are also essential, especially when running the motor at high speeds or for extended periods. Always refer to the manufacturer’s specifications for exact values and recommendations to ensure safe and efficient operation.
